asp.net2.0实用案例教程-PPT


ASP.NET 2.0是微软开发的一个用于构建Web应用程序的框架,它是在.NET Framework 2.0版本上构建的。这个框架提供了丰富的功能和工具,让开发者能够更高效地创建动态、交互性强的网站和应用程序。本教程通过PPT的形式,深入浅出地介绍了ASP.NET 2.0的关键概念和技术,旨在帮助学习者掌握实际开发中的应用。 在ASP.NET 2.0中,一些主要知识点包括: 1. **页面生命周期**:理解ASP.NET页面从请求到响应的完整生命周期至关重要。这涉及到页面初始化、加载、验证、呈现和卸载等阶段,每个阶段都有相应的事件可以处理。 2. **控件和事件模型**:ASP.NET 2.0引入了丰富的服务器控件,如文本框、按钮、表格等,它们有自己的生命周期和事件处理机制。通过这些控件,开发者可以轻松地创建用户界面,并通过事件驱动编程响应用户的交互。 3. **数据绑定**:ASP.NET 2.0提供了一种强大的数据绑定机制,允许将数据库或其他数据源的数据动态地显示在网页上。例如,GridView和Repeater控件是常用的数据展示控件。 4. **状态管理**:在Web应用中,由于其无状态性,ASP.NET 2.0提供了多种状态管理技术,如视图状态、隐藏字段、Session和Cookie,以便在页面间保持数据。 5. **配置和部署**:ASP.NET 2.0的配置文件(web.config)使得开发者能方便地更改应用程序的行为而无需重新编译。同时,学习如何部署ASP.NET应用程序到IIS服务器也是实践中的重要环节。 6. ** Membership 和角色管理**:ASP.NET 2.0包含了一套强大的身份验证和授权系统,允许开发者轻松实现用户注册、登录、角色分配等功能,这对于构建安全的Web应用非常重要。 7. **缓存技术**:为了提高性能,ASP.NET 2.0提供了多种缓存策略,如页面缓存、部分缓存和数据缓存,学习如何合理利用这些策略可以显著提升应用程序的响应速度。 8. **Web服务和AJAX支持**:ASP.NET 2.0支持创建和消费Web服务,以及通过ASP.NET AJAX扩展实现客户端的异步更新,从而提供更流畅的用户体验。 9. **错误处理和调试**:理解和使用如Try-Catch异常处理结构,以及Visual Studio提供的调试工具,可以帮助开发者快速定位并解决问题。 10. **MVC模式**:虽然ASP.NET 2.0主要是基于Web Forms的,但它也引入了对MVC(Model-View-Controller)模式的支持,为开发者提供了另一种设计和组织代码的方式。 通过本“ASP.NET 2.0实用案例教程-PPT”,学习者将不仅了解这些理论知识,还能看到实际的示例和步骤,以加深理解和应用。教程中的PPT可能会涵盖各个主题的详细讲解,包括每项技术的使用场景、代码示例和最佳实践,对于初学者和有一定基础的开发者都是宝贵的参考资料。通过实际操作和练习,你可以更好地掌握ASP.NET 2.0,为今后的Web开发工作打下坚实的基础。
































- 1


- 粉丝: 0
我的内容管理 展开
我的资源 快来上传第一个资源
我的收益
登录查看自己的收益我的积分 登录查看自己的积分
我的C币 登录后查看C币余额
我的收藏
我的下载
下载帮助


最新资源
- 机械学院机械设计制造及其自动化专业培养方案三学期制用.doc
- 人工神经网络绪论专家讲座.pptx
- 人事发卡软件使用说明.doc
- 中医科学院无线网络覆盖施工方案样本.doc
- 2023年互联网竞赛策划.doc
- 网络营销知识产品管理层次.pptx
- 网络工程设计CH9.pptx
- 系统集成与综合布线工程监理.ppt
- 工业机器人离线编程ABB5-5-创建工具.pptx
- 网络系统安全评估及高危漏洞ppt(精品文档).ppt
- 无限极网络直销好做吗.ppt
- 设施农业自动化实施方案.ppt
- 项目管理的通俗例子[最终版].pdf
- 数据库课程设计任务书扉及格式说明计算机.doc
- 最新国家开放大学电大《物流管理基础答案》网络核心课形考网考作业.docx
- 无线传感器网络54930.ppt


